About Kelly Blanchard
Kelly Blanchard is a scholar working on Obstetrics and Gynecology,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health and Pediatrics, Perinatology and Child Health, having authored 150 papers that have together received 3.5k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Reproductive Health and Contraception (91 papers), Adolescent Sexual and Reproductive Health (45 papers) and Maternal and Perinatal Health Interventions (43 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Obstetrics and Gynecology (857 citations), Microbiology (539 citations) and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health (2.1k citations). Kelly Blanchard has collaborated with scholars based in United States, South Africa and United Kingdom. Frequent co-authors include Daniel Grossman, Amanda Dennis, Gita Ramjee, Beverly Winikoff, Charlotte Ellertson, Ariane van der Straten, Guy de Bruyn, Elizabeth Montgomery, Kate Grindlay and Nancy Padian. Their work appears in journals such as The Lancet, S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ología and PLoS ONE.
